Foreword

The first thing you need to know about Jamie Smart is this: He's nuts.

I'm not talking about the ‘locked in a padded cell, claiming to be Napoleon’ kind of nuts. I'm talking about something much more dangerous; the ‘here's to the crazy ones’ kind of nuts. The ‘willing to be true to yourself and do whatever it takes, no matter what the cost’ kind of nuts. The kind that sets out to do the impossible and transforms how you see the world in the process. The totally lovable kind of nuts.

I first met Jamie in 2006, shortly after I sold my digital startup to BSkyB. In the course of the conversation, he asked me if I'd mentor him on growing his business. I refused, not because I didn't want to, but because I simply didn't have the time, but the second thing you need to know about Jamie is this: He's persistent. Extremely persistent. He kept asking and I kept refusing over the course of several weeks until finally, we made a deal: I would mentor him, but if we agreed something was the right thing for him to do, and he didn't do it, I would fire him as a client.

I expected this arrangement only to last a few weeks, but it's now 10 years later, and I still haven't fired him. Instead, he's become a dear friend, and we've each grown in ways that neither of us could have anticipated. Both of us have walked away from ‘sure thing’ ventures to follow our hearts. I left Smarta, the company I founded and grew through the midst of the recession. Jamie left the field he was a leader in and headed in the opposite direction to explore the principles behind clarity of mind and high-performance. And that's the third thing about Jamie: He's willing to follow the truth, wherever it leads. When my first book Stop Talking, Start Doing got knocked off the top of the bestseller charts after 14 months at number 1, it was no surprise to me that his first book CLARITY was the one that took its place.

Which brings us to Jamie's latest book, RESULTS: Think Less, Achieve More.
